CAN YOU REVERSE DIABETES WITH A RAW FOOD DIET?

The global epidemic of diabetes is growing and so are the numbers of new trends. Amidst all claims and advertisements, it is important to understand the root and nature of your disease.
With type1 diabetes, a reversal cannot be your goal but a healthy diet is a part of your treatment to maintain euglycemia. Moreover, studies suggest that reversal could be possible in type 2 diabetes with intensive lifestyle intervention (ILT).

Dietary modification is an important element of lifestyle intervention along with other medications.


THE RAW FOOD DIET

Raw food diet or otherwise called raw foodism or raw veganism is one of the diets which eliminates all of the processed and ultra-processed foods.
Consisting mostly of fruits, vegetables, nuts, and seeds this diet is quite similar to veganism. Unlike a vegan diet, foods that are not cooked over 40- 48degree Celsius are only eaten in a raw food diet. Foods like yogurt, kefir, kombucha and sauerkraut which are simply processed and fermented are also included in this diet.
Foods undergoing intense processing with pesticides, fertilizers, and other preservatives are eliminated.
Most of your fruit and vegetable juices and salads can also be eaten on a raw food diet.

RAW FOODISM AND DIABETES

For diabetics, raw foods can be beneficial in different ways. Firstly, no processed foods implying no junk foods can help in achieving the goal of weight loss for overweight individuals.
Ultimately, with this diet, you can stay away from all possible added sugars and preservatives which when consumed could cause blood sugar spikes.
Consuming raw foods like minimally sauteed vegetables, fruits, nuts and seeds, vegetable juices, and salads is a rich source of fiber and can keep you satiated for a long time. They are digested slowly and ensure gradual blood sugar changes without sudden peaks.
These unprocessed foods also retain many vitamins and minerals which could also be beneficial.

DEPENDING ON RAW FOODISM FOR DIABETES REVERSAL

As fancy as it may sound, raw food diet cannot be your only solution to reverse diabetes. With the benefit of fiber and other nutrients, raw foods can be a part of your diet but you need not transform your entire diet.
Cereals and pulses are staples of the Indian diet and without them and other cooked meals your diet would become deficient in calories, protein, and other vital nutrients.
Reversal of diabetes is not possible by changing only your diet and missing out on other factors. For effective reversal, at the early stages, intensive lifestyle intervention which includes a healthy diet, exercise, and stress management is extremely important. Yet you cannot neglect your medications as well. It is important to be on par with all these 4 interventions for both reversal and controlling your diabetes.
Dietary supplements (which are excluded from raw food diet) like chromium, magnesium, and omega-3 fatty acids are also prescribed in certain cases.

THE BOTTOM LINE

Reversal of diabetes may not be possible for all individuals, but for some, it is still an achievable goal. Instead of completely revamping your meals based on one particular trend, it is better to focus on a wholesome diet with adequate nutrients, regular exercise, stress management, and regular medications.
